Warm, windproof, water-resistant—the Baby Nano Puff® Jacket uses incredibly lightweight and highly compressible PrimaLoft® Gold Insulation Eco 100% postconsumer recycled polyester with P.U.R.E.™ (Produced Using Reduced Emissions) technology, wrapped in a 100% recycled polyester shell and lining. Fair Trade Certified™ sewn.

100% Recycled Polyester Shell Fabric
Lightweight, windproof shell is made of Pertex® Quantum Eco 100% recycled polyester, with high tear-strength and a DWR (durable water repellent) finish -
Insulation: PrimaLoft® Gold Insulation Eco
60-g PrimaLoft® Gold Insulation Eco 100% postconsumer recycled polyester with P.U.R.E.™ (Produced Using Reduced Emissions) technology provides excellent warmth for its weight and stays warm when wet -
Quilted Pattern
Unique quilt pattern holds insulation in place -
Full-Length, Center-Front Zipper
Full-length zipper with zipper garage, reflective webbing pull and internal wind flap; two zippered handwarmer pockets with reflective webbing pulls -
Elastane Binding
Elastane binding at sleeve openings for a secure fit -
Designed to Hand Down
Hand-me-down ID label -
Supporting The People Who Made This Product
Fair Trade Certified™ sewn, which means the people who made them earned a premium for their labor -
Country of Origin
Made in Vietnam. -
Weight
147 g (5.2 oz)
- Shell: 1.6-oz 30-denier Pertex® Quantum Eco 100% recycled polyester ripstop with a DWR (durable water repellent) finish
- Lining: 2.2-oz 100% recycled polyester taffeta with a PFC-free DWR finish (durable water repellent coating that does not contain perfluorinated chemicals)
- Insulation: 60-g PrimaLoft® Gold Insulation Eco 100% postconsumer recycled polyester with P.U.R.E.™ (Produced Using Reduced Emissions) technology
- Shell fabric is certified as bluesign® approved
- Fair Trade Certified™ sewn
